首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

修改ArrayList内部数组中的单个元素

是指在ArrayList中修改指定索引位置上的元素值。ArrayList是Java中的动态数组,它可以根据需要自动调整大小。在修改ArrayList内部数组中的单个元素时,可以按照以下步骤进行操作:

  1. 首先,创建一个ArrayList对象,并添加一些元素。例如:
代码语言:txt
复制
ArrayList<String> list = new ArrayList<>();
list.add("元素1");
list.add("元素2");
list.add("元素3");
  1. 要修改ArrayList中的元素,需要使用set()方法。该方法接受两个参数:要修改的元素的索引和新的元素值。例如,要将索引为1的元素修改为"新元素",可以使用以下代码:
代码语言:txt
复制
list.set(1, "新元素");
  1. 修改后,ArrayList中的元素已被更新。可以通过get()方法来验证修改结果。例如,要获取索引为1的元素,可以使用以下代码:
代码语言:txt
复制
String element = list.get(1);
System.out.println(element); // 输出:新元素

需要注意的是,ArrayList的索引从0开始,因此第一个元素的索引为0,第二个元素的索引为1,依此类推。

ArrayList的优势是它可以动态调整大小,不需要手动管理数组的大小。它还提供了许多方便的方法来操作元素,如添加、删除、获取和修改等。

ArrayList的应用场景包括但不限于:

  • 在需要频繁插入、删除元素的场景中,ArrayList比较适用,因为它可以自动调整大小,不需要手动处理数组的大小。
  • 在需要按索引访问元素的场景中,ArrayList的性能比较好,因为它可以通过索引直接访问元素,而不需要遍历整个列表。
  • 在需要对元素进行排序、查找等操作的场景中,ArrayList提供了相应的方法,方便进行这些操作。

腾讯云提供了云计算相关的产品,其中与ArrayList类似的产品是COS(对象存储),它提供了类似于文件系统的存储服务,可以方便地存储和访问数据。您可以通过以下链接了解腾讯云COS的详细信息:腾讯云COS产品介绍

请注意,以上答案仅供参考,具体的产品选择和使用应根据实际需求和情况进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券